LAWS OF KENYA

STATE CORPORATIONS ACT

NYAYO TEA ZONES DEVELOPMENT CORPORATION ORDER

LEGAL NOTICE 30 OF 2002

  • Published in Kenya Gazette Vol. CIV—No. 15 on 8 March 2002
  • Commenced on 8 March 2002
  1. [Revised by 24th Annual Supplement (Legal Notice 221 of 2023) on 31 December 2022]

1. Citation

This Order may be cited as the Nyayo Tea Zones Development Corporation Order.

2. Establishment of the Corporation

There is hereby established a state Corporation, to be known as the Nyayo Tea Zones Development Corporation (hereinafter called "the Corporation") which shall be a body corporate with a Board constituted in accordance with section 6(1) of the Act.

3. Powers and function of the Corporation

(1)
(a)The Corporation shall, in consultation with the Chief Conservator of Forests, create tea and fuel wood growing zones to be known as the "Nyayo Tea Zones", in gazetted forests and gazetted trust land forests in those areas of Kenya where the Kenya Tea Development Agency does not, in accordance with the Schedule to the Kenya Tea Development Agency Order (Sub. Leg.), operate.
(b)After the creation of the tea and fuel wood growing zones, the land shall be vested and become the property of the Corporation for the purposes of this Order.
(c)Any tea and fuel wood growing areas created and developed in gazetted forests and trust lands forests by the Government prior to the making of this Order, shall be deemed to have been created by the Corporation for the purpose of this Order.
(d)The zones so created under subparagraph (1) shall serve as buffer zones to protect and conserve the forests, rehabilitate the ecologically fragile areas by planting tea, indigenous trees, fuel wood plantations and other suitable tree crops.
(2)The Corporation shall manage and foster the development of tea growing and forest conservation in the zones created under subparagraph (1) and shall for that purpose in the zones—
(a)establish, manage and develop tea and fuel wood plantations;
(b)establish and manage nurseries for the propagation of tea and forest tree seedlings;
(c)establish, manage and maintain tea processing factories and process tea therein;
(d)construct and maintain access roads, offices and green leaf buying centres; and
(e)empower its officers to safeguard its assets in the field.
(3)The Corporation may buy and process tea from areas outside the zones created under section 3(1)(a) but it shall only buy and process tea from areas where the Kenya Tea Development Agency operates with the consent of that Agency, which consent shall not be unduly withheld.
(4)The Corporation may enter into agreements with competent tea and fuel wood plantation firms as well as tea processing factories for the purpose of establishing plantations and processing tea produced by the Corporation.
(5)The Corporation shall have the sole right to transport, lease, sell or market in Kenya or outside Kenya any tea, wood and other products produced or processed by it or on its behalf.
(6)In addition to the powers and functions specified in this paragraph, the Corporation shall perform such other functions as may be necessary for the performance of its functions under this Order.

4. Revocation

Legal Notice Number 265/1986 is hereby revoked.
